32F8104-CN by Texas Instruments

32F8104-CN by Texas Instruments is a small outline active filter with continuous time filtering. It operates b/w 0-70°C, has 7 poles and zeros, and a cutoff frequency range of 2900-9000 kHz. Ideal for commercial applications requiring lowpass Bessel transfer characteristics in a compact design.

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
